What is a Steel Structural Takeoff?

A structural steel takeoff is the process of identifying, measuring, and calculating the exact quantities of steel materials required for a construction project. Estimators review engineering drawings to determine:

  • Steel type (I-beams, H-beams, columns, trusses, braces)
  • Dimensions (length, width, thickness, height)
  • Specifications (connections, load capacity, fittings)

A precise structural steel takeoff supports:

  • Better cost estimation
  • Accurate procurement planning
  • Reduced waste and rework
  • On-time project delivery

In short, structural steel takeoffs ensure you order the right materials at the right time, without overruns or shortages.

Why Structural Steel Takeoffs Matter in Construction?

Accurate steel takeoffs are the backbone of every profitable construction project. They help contractors:

  1. Precisely estimate costs: Prevent material overordering and underordering
  2. Procure materials efficiently: Avoid shipment delays and supply chain disruptions
  3. Submit competitive bids: Create sharper proposals with accurate numbers
  4. Maintain schedule certainty: Prevent delays caused by missing elements or design changes

If your structural steel takeoff is off, even slightly, it impacts pricing, timelines, and profitability.

How to Perform a Structural Steel Takeoff?

There are two main ways contractors prepare a structural steel takeoff:

  1. Manual Takeoffs
  2. Digital Takeoff Software 

1. Manual Takeoffs

This traditional method involves examining drawings and manually calculating steel quantities.

Process includes:

  • Reviewing architectural & structural plans
  • Measuring each steel component individually
  • Calculating lengths, weights, and connections
  • Recording quantities in spreadsheets or templates

Limitations of manual takeoffs:

  • Highly time-consuming: Complex projects may require days of measurement.
  • High chance of human error: Misreading drawings or miscalculating tonnage is common.
  • Difficult for complicated structures: Large commercial or industrial projects overwhelm manual workflows.

2. Digital Takeoff Software

Traditional construction takeoff software improved efficiency by allowing estimators to trace components digitally.

Advantages:

  • Faster than measuring with rulers or scales
  • Easier organization of quantities
  • Digital storage of all measurements

Limitations:

  • Still requires manual clicking, dragging, and measurement
  • Slows down when handling large project volumes
  • Limited automation, meaning you still spend hours tracing
  • Turnaround time depends heavily on the estimator workload

Even with digital tools, the structural steel takeoff process remains repetitive, slow, and bandwidth-heavy.
